Transaction 84e57ba05380ed17d920b2648154107d03f6fecd3c4c46bcd214afb873d0d904
1 Input
1 Output
-
84e57ba05380ed17d920b2648154107d03f6fecd3c4c46bcd214afb873d0d904:0
- value
- 891381
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ddcc7566bceff87aead1a166c1635e77ec32cfa7
- address
- bc1qmhx82e4ualu846k359nvzc67wlkr9na879hvlm